KENNESAW, Ga., March 18, 2024 – Castles Technology, a premier provider of innovative payment solutions worldwide, today announced a significant move towards enhancing its growth and expansion strategies in North America by appointing Joe Mach as the Chief Executive Officer.

This appointment marks a pivotal step in Castles Technology’s mission to revolutionize the payment solutions sector through a focus on innovation, partnership, and customer-centric approaches across the United States, Canada, and Mexico.

Joe Mach, a veteran in the payments industry, brings to the table over two decades of leadership experience and a track record of success, including his most recent role as CEO and President of ENS. At ENS, Mach played a critical role in providing state-of-the-art mobile and point-of-sale mounting solutions to a vast majority of the top US retailers. His extensive background also includes significant tenure at Verifone, where as President of Verifone Americas, he spearheaded growth initiatives targeting key segments of the market.

Expressing his enthusiasm about his new role, Joe Mach stated, “I am honored to join Castles Technology and lead its North America region. My foremost goal is to cultivate and fortify strategic partnerships that drive collaborative success, paving the way for innovation and growth together. Castles is poised to be the partner of choice in the payments space, and I am committed to leading our team towards that vision.”

At the heart of Castles Technology’s strategy is its commitment to delivering secure, innovative payment solutions that cater to the unique needs of businesses through capabilities like OEM/ODM, white-labeling, and product customization. This approach ensures tailored payment solutions that align with the specific requirements of their clientele.

Kevin Hsin, Global Chairman of Castles Technology, commented on Mach’s appointment, saying, “With Joe on board, Castles Technology is poised to elevate and further localize its presence in North America’s dynamic payment sector. His deep understanding of the payments industry and US market, coupled with his partner-first approach, will enable us to capitalize on emerging opportunities and deliver unparalleled value to our customers.”

As Castles Technology continues to forge ahead in the North American market, the leadership of Joe Mach is set to catalyze the company’s vision of becoming the leading partner in the payments industry, fostering innovation, and driving growth in collaboration with its strategic partners.
